SSC Stenographer Grade ‘C’ & ‘D’ Examination, 2026; Online Application!

The Staff Selection Commission (SSC), under the Ministry of Personnel, Public Grievances & Pensions, Department of Personnel and Training, has released a notice for the Open Competitive Computer-Based Examination for recruitment to the posts of Stenographer Grade ‘C’ & Stenographer Grade ‘D’ (Group ‘C’). There are 731 vacancies for posts in various Ministries/Departments/Organizations. The examination is scheduled for July – August 2026.

Eligibility Criteria: Stenographer Grade ‘C’ & ‘D’

  1. Educational Qualification: Candidates must have passed 12th standard or equivalent examination from a recognized Board or University as on or before the cut-off date i.e. 01.08.2026.
  2. Skills Requirement: Only those candidates who have skills in stenography are eligible to apply.

Age Limit (as on 01.08.2026):

  1. Stenographer Grade ‘C’: 18 to 30 years.
  2. Stenographer Grade ‘D’: 18 to 27 years.

Age Relaxation:

  • SC/ST: 5 years
  • OBC: 3 years
  • PwBD (Unreserved/EWS): 10 years
  • PwBD (OBC): 13 years
  • PwBD (SC/ST): 15 years
  • Ex-Servicemen (ESM): 03 years after deduction of military service rendered from the actual age.
  • Central Govt. Civilian Employees (3+ years continuous service) for Group ‘C’ posts: Up to 40 years of age.
  • Widows/Divorced Women/Women judicially separated (Unreserved): Up to 35 years of age.

Application Fee:

  • General candidates: ₹100/- (Rs One Hundred Only).
  • Women candidates and candidates belonging to SC, ST, PwBD, and ESM eligible for reservation are exempted from payment of fee.

Selection Process & Examination Scheme:

  1. Computer Based Examination (CBE):
    • Part I: General Intelligence & Reasoning (50 Questions, 50 Marks)
    • Part II: General Awareness (50 Questions, 50 Marks)
    • Part III: English Language and Comprehension (100 Questions, 100 Marks)
    • Total Duration: 2 Hours (with sectional timer of 30 Minutes each for Part I & Part II and 60 Minutes for Part III).
    • Negative Marking: There will be negative marking of 0.25 marks for each wrong answer.
  2. Skill Test in Stenography: This test is mandatory but qualifying in nature.
    • Stenographer Grade ‘C’: Dictation will be for 10 minutes at the speed of 100 w.p.m..
    • Stenographer Grade ‘D’: Dictation will be for 10 minutes at the speed of 80 w.p.m.

Apply Procedure:

  • Applications must be submitted only in online mode at the new SSC Headquarter website: https://ssc.gov.in or through the my SSC mobile application.
  • Candidates must complete a One-Time Registration (OTR) on the new website if they have not done so already.
  • For the online application, a live photograph of the candidate must be captured when prompted by the application module, unless opting for Aadhaar Based Authentication.
  • Payment of fee can be made online through BHIM UPI, Net Banking, or by using Visa, Mastercard, Maestro, or RuPay Debit cards.

Dates to remember

  • Start date for Online Applications: 24-04-2026
  • Last date for Online Applications: 15-05-2026 (23:00 hrs)
  • Last date for online fee payment: 16-05-2026 (23:00 hrs)
  • Application Form Correction Window: 20-05-2026 to 21-05-2026 (23:00 hrs)
